## Deploying Proselint-ish (our docs linter)

Welcome aboard! Deploying the Thistledown docs linter is pretty painless: it ships as a single binary and runs behind the Marrowgate proxy. Push to the release branch, wait for the green check, and the rollout handles itself. Before your first deploy, double-check that your environment matches the defaults shown below.

config for tawif-bagef:
[sorwyn]
team = sorys
access_code = ac_9ba40c
host = sorwyn.ordingrid.local
port = 5000
owner = aldok.quenion
peer = belath.paliqcloud.local

Finance Review Summary — Insurance Renewal

For the incoming director: the annual renewal with Cravenmoor Assurance was completed in March, covering the Byfield plant and the Ostenholm depot. Premiums rose 8% following last year's flood claim, partially offset by a higher deductible on equipment cover. Broker performance was satisfactory, though alternatives were quoted. Context on our wider positioning appears in the note that follows.

internal memo for fajog-yagaf: Gross margin on Ulaael came in at 20 percent against a plan of 10 percent. Only 9 of the 80 pilot accounts renewed Ulaael, so a churn review is set for July 1.

## Step 4: Move the order-cutoff rule

Heads up: CrumbQueue used to hardcode the 2pm cutoff for next-day bakery orders at Flourhaus. That's gone now — the cutoff lives in config, so Maribel's team can tweak it per-store without a deploy. After you flip the flag, double-check that late orders actually bounce; last time someone forgot and we got a flood of midnight croissant requests for the Pinewood Junction branch. Once the service restarts cleanly, paste in the settings below exactly as shown.

service settings:
PRAIX_LOG_LEVEL=error
PRAIX_METRICS_HOST=metrics.praix.qorvelcorp.corp
PRAIX_POOL_SIZE=16